    Adesina Seeks Support for Africa

    Dr. Akinwumi Adesina has urged for more American investment in Africa’s Agricultural sector.

    Dr. Akinwumi Adesina urges for more American investment in Africa’s Agricultural sector.

    Dr Akinwunmi Adesina, President of the African Development Bank (AfDB), commented on the huge wealth-creating agric sector primed to unleash new economic opportunities and lift hundreds of millions of people out of poverty in Africa.

    This statement was made at the recently completed 94th United States Department of Agriculture (USDA), Agricultural Outlook Forum in Virginia themed ‘Root of Prosperity’. 

    According to him, the prospect of agribusinesses in Africa is expected to reach 1trillion USD in 2030, therefore, emphasizing the huge economic potential in the continent.

    He concluded his discussion by promising that AfDB will be a frontier of transformative agribusiness and initiatives.
